Steps to Care for Your Adjustable Lift Bed

Maintaining an adjustable lift bed requires specific care to protect its performance and longevity. Regular maintenance includes checking mechanical components for damage, making certain that moving parts function properly. It is advisable to periodically test the motor and remote control to verify they are operating properly and replace batteries if needed.

It is equally important to clean the bed frame and mattress. A soft wipe with a wet cloth removes dust and grime, and vacuuming the mattress helps eliminate allergens. Using a fabric cleaner on fabric-covered mattresses can preserve their appearance.

Additionally, it is important to avoid loading the bed with too much weight, as this can strain the lifting mechanism. Following the manufacturer's weight guidelines guarantees peak performance. Finally, consider storing the remote control in a designated place to prevent losing it, making it easier of use when changing the bed's position.

Do Flexible Height Beds Work with All Sleep Surfaces?

Adjustable lift beds are generally suitable for various mattress types, including foam, latex, and hybrid. However, innerspring mattresses may require careful consideration because of their design, which can affect functionality and support on adjustable bases.

How much mass is able to an adjustable lifting cot carry?

Adjustable lift beds commonly support between 400 to 800 pounds, depending on the model and construction. It is vital to review the manufacturer's specifications to confirm compatibility with specific mattress types and overall weight capacity.

Is Specialized Bedding Necessary for Modifiable Lift Beds?

Adjustable lift beds commonly do not call for special bedding; however, employing mattresses made for adjustable bases enhances ease and functionality. It is prudent to select malleable materials that can accommodate the bed's movements adequately.

Are there safety elements for variable lift beds?

Adjustable lift beds often include safety devices like locking mechanisms, weight sensors, and emergency stop buttons. These components are built to avoid accidents and promote user safety when adjusting and positioning the bed.

Can Flexible Height Adjustable Beds Be Broken Down for Shifting?

Yes, variable lift beds are usually able to be broken down for moving. Most models have modular components, making transportation easier. However, it's recommended to review the manufacturer’s guidelines for precise disassembly instructions and safety warnings.
